In 2020, The Salty Donut implemented Gusto Benefits, adopting Gusto Benefits as its central Benefits Administration platform for a 90-employee retail operation in the United States. The deployment was positioned as a single hub for managing employees, with configuration focused on benefits enrollment, employee self-service, eligibility tracking, plan setup, and open enrollment workflows common to Benefits Administration solutions. The implementation emphasizes a well designed, flexible interface intended for use by HR and people managers across the company. Configuration and operational scope centered on full feature adoption, with the HR function using the platform to administer employee benefits and to provide employees direct access to enrollment and plan information. Governance shifted to platform-driven enrollment windows and role-based access for HR administrators and managers, supporting centralized benefits lifecycle processes. The co-founder reported they use every single feature and functionality within Gusto and expressed high satisfaction, indicating company-wide adoption and sustained operational use of Gusto Benefits.

In 2022, The Salty Donut launched Lunchbox Ordering as an Online Food Ordering System. The rollout emphasized direct channels and processed over 15,800 first party orders within the first few months while quickly achieving high app store ratings in the United States. The Salty Donut implemented Lunchbox Ordering to centralize digital ordering across mobile and web storefronts. Functional usage is inferred to include app and web ordering plus loyalty and marketing capabilities, reflecting ordering and CRM workflows highlighted in the case study. Typical Online Food Ordering System functionality appears to be configured for menu management, order routing and mobile storefront performance, with ordering data feeding loyalty and customer relationship workflows. Lunchbox Ordering is described in the deployment as the primary engine for consumer ordering and in‑app engagement. Operational scope covered consumer ordering across the United States and impacted marketing, store operations and customer service functions through centralized order and promotion controls. The deployment timeline was rapid, focused on app store distribution and first party order capture, and required governance over menu and promotion consistency across channels. Ongoing operations likely emphasize orchestration between ordering, loyalty and CRM processes to maintain app performance and customer experience. The documented outcomes include more than 15,800 first party orders in the initial months and high app store ratings, reinforcing the role of Lunchbox Ordering as the primary Online Food Ordering System for The Salty Donut. The implementation positioned The Salty Donut to capture first party customer data for loyalty and CRM activities and to operate consolidated ordering workflows across mobile and web channels.

The Salty Donut is a Retail organization based in United States, with around 90 employees and annual revenues of $8.0 million.
The Salty Donut operates a diverse technology stack with applications such as Gusto Benefits, Microsoft 365 and Lunchbox Ordering, covering areas like Benefits Administration, Collaboration and Online Food Ordering System.
The Salty Donut has invested in cloud applications and AI-driven platforms to optimize efficiency and growth, collaborating with vendors such as Gusto, Microsoft and Lunchbox.
The Salty Donut recently adopted applications including Zoho Mail in 2023, Microsoft Entra ID (formerly Azure Active Directory) in 2023 and Slack Connect in 2022, highlighting its ongoing modernization strategy.
